## Step 4: Enable Dark Mode — Corvid Admin Dashboard

Pull the latest `theme-core` package before starting. Dark mode in Corvid is config-driven: no component edits, no inline styles. Replace the legacy palette block in each environment file, then restart the dashboard service so tokens reload. Verify contrast on the audit log and billing views — those two screens had hardcoded backgrounds in the old build and will look broken if any token is missing. Once verified, commit the environment file containing the values shown below.

service settings:
PRAIX_LOG_LEVEL=error
PRAIX_METRICS_HOST=metrics.praix.qorvelcorp.corp
PRAIX_POOL_SIZE=16

Subject: Queuewright cut-over — done

Hi, and welcome aboard! Quick recap before you dig in: we swapped the old cron-based scaler for Queuewright on Tuesday. It now scales workers off queue depth directly, so the Monday-morning backlog spikes clear in minutes instead of an hour. A couple of rough edges remain around scale-down hysteresis — notes in the wiki. The settings we landed on after tuning are below.

settings of tagef-bawif:
DRUIX_HOST=druix.zemvarlabs.internal
DRUIX_PORT=8000

## Releases

Quick note for the sync: the nightly search reindex on Mossgate now ships as its own release artifact instead of piggybacking on the API deploy. It runs at 01:30, takes ~20 minutes, and rolls back automatically on checksum mismatch. Artifacts must be signed before the runner will touch them. The key we sign reindex artifacts with is below.

release key, bagep-yajof: bky19_xtqFhCW5hRYj5CXT2ZJ